One ad platform, two audiences
Facebook and Instagram run on the same system: Meta Ads Manager. Treating them as one program means a single budget, shared audiences, and creative that adapts to wherever it lands, whether that is the feed, Reels, or Stories. Most Philippine businesses find their customers on both, so we plan for both from the start.
Campaigns built around objectives
Every campaign begins with what you actually need: leads, sales, traffic, or reach. From there we structure the account, define the audiences, and shape the message for each stage of the funnel. Boosting a post has its place, but it is not a strategy, and it rarely gives you the targeting or the data to improve on.
Tracking that tells you the truth
We set up the Meta Pixel and the Conversions API so results are attributed properly rather than guessed at. That covers events, audiences, and the reporting behind them. When tracking is right, you can see which campaigns earn their budget and which ones need work.
Creative, testing, and budget
We design the creative and write the copy, then test variations to find what resonates. Budget moves toward what is performing, and we watch frequency and fatigue so your best ads do not wear out the audience seeing them.
Reporting you can act on
Monthly reporting covers spend, results, cost per outcome, and what we are changing next. We measure against your goals and against the month before, so you always know where the money went and what it brought back.
